In-depth Look: Manufacturing Processes and Quality Assurance for global sources aspirator bulb model fuli-s
What Are the Key Stages in the Manufacturing Process of the Fuli-S Aspirator Bulb?
The manufacturing process of the Fuli-S aspirator bulb involves several critical stages that ensure the final product meets safety and performance standards. These stages include material preparation, forming, assembly, and finishing.
Material Preparation
The first step involves sourcing high-quality materials, primarily soft silicone, which is essential for the aspirator bulb’s flexibility and safety. Manufacturers typically prioritize silicone that is BPA-free and compliant with international safety standards. This material is then subjected to quality checks to ensure it meets the required specifications for medical-grade use.
What Techniques Are Used for Forming the Aspirator Bulb?
The forming stage is where the silicone is shaped into the bulb form. Common techniques include injection molding and blow molding.
- Injection Molding: This method involves injecting molten silicone into a mold to create the bulb shape. It allows for precise control over the dimensions and ensures uniform thickness, which is crucial for maintaining suction efficiency.
- Blow Molding: In some cases, blow molding is used to create the bulb. This technique is beneficial for creating hollow objects and can be more cost-effective for larger production runs.
Both techniques are designed to minimize waste and maximize efficiency, which is essential for keeping production costs competitive.
How Is the Assembly Process Conducted?
After forming, the next stage is assembly, where the individual components of the aspirator bulb are brought together. This typically includes attaching any additional elements, such as the nozzle. The assembly process is often automated to ensure consistency, but skilled workers are also involved in quality assurance checks to confirm that each component fits properly and functions as intended.
What Finishing Techniques Are Applied to the Fuli-S Aspirator Bulb?
Finishing involves several processes that enhance the product’s usability and aesthetics. This includes surface treatment to improve grip and comfort, as well as cleaning and sterilization to ensure that the bulbs are safe for medical use. Products might be subjected to additional quality checks during this stage to ensure that no contaminants remain.

What Are the Key Quality Control Checkpoints in the Manufacturing Process?
Quality control (QC) checkpoints are established throughout the manufacturing process to ensure that each bulb meets the necessary standards.
What Are the Main QC Checkpoints?
- Incoming Quality Control (IQC): This initial checkpoint involves inspecting the raw materials upon arrival to ensure they meet specifications before they are used in production.
- In-Process Quality Control (IPQC): During manufacturing, various checks are performed to monitor the production process. This includes verifying the dimensions and functionality of the bulbs at various stages.
- Final Quality Control (FQC): After assembly, each bulb undergoes a comprehensive inspection and testing process to confirm that it functions correctly and is free from defects.
What Common Testing Methods Are Employed for the Fuli-S Aspirator Bulb?
Testing methods may include:
- Suction Performance Tests: Measuring the suction capacity of the bulb to ensure it meets the required standards for effective mucus removal.
- Material Safety Testing: Ensuring that the silicone used is free from harmful chemicals and meets safety standards.
- Durability Tests: Assessing the bulb’s resilience against repeated use and sterilization processes.

Comprehensive Cost and Pricing Analysis for global sources aspirator bulb model fuli-s Sourcing
What Are the Key Cost Components in Sourcing the Fuli-S Aspirator Bulb?
When analyzing the cost structure for the Fuli-S aspirator bulb, several core components must be considered. These include materials, labor, manufacturing overhead, tooling, quality control (QC), logistics, and the supplier’s profit margin.
-
Materials: The primary material used in the Fuli-S aspirator bulb is high-quality, BPA-free silicone. This choice not only enhances safety for infants but also affects the overall cost due to material quality. Lower-quality alternatives could reduce costs but compromise safety and functionality.
-
Labor: Labor costs can vary significantly depending on the manufacturing location. In countries with lower labor costs, such as those in Southeast Asia, the overall cost of production may be reduced. However, this can also influence quality if not managed properly.
-
Manufacturing Overhead: This includes costs associated with the factory’s operational expenses, such as utilities and equipment depreciation. Efficient manufacturing processes can help minimize these costs, which can be passed on to buyers.
-
Tooling: Initial tooling costs can be substantial, especially if custom molds are required for specific designs or features of the aspirator bulb. These costs are typically amortized over the production run, impacting the unit price.
-
Quality Control (QC): Ensuring that the aspirator bulbs meet safety and performance standards incurs additional costs. Manufacturers often implement rigorous QC processes to comply with international health standards, particularly for medical devices.
-
Logistics: Shipping costs can be a significant factor, especially for international buyers. Incoterms (International Commercial Terms) will dictate who bears these costs and risks. For instance, CIF (Cost, Insurance, and Freight) terms will typically include shipping in the price, while FOB (Free on Board) places the shipping responsibility on the buyer.
-
Margin: Finally, the supplier’s profit margin will influence the final price. Factors such as brand reputation, market demand, and competition can dictate how much margin a supplier can reasonably charge.

What Are the Common Trade Terminology and Jargon in the Aspirator Bulb Market?
Familiarity with industry terminology is vital for B2B buyers to navigate purchasing decisions effectively. Here are some commonly used terms related to the Fuli-S aspirator bulb:
-
OEM (Original Equipment Manufacturer): What Does It Imply?
OEM refers to companies that produce parts or products that are then marketed by another company. In the context of the Fuli-S aspirator bulb, buyers may encounter OEM products that offer similar specifications at competitive prices. Understanding OEM can help buyers assess quality and sourcing options. -
MOQ (Minimum Order Quantity): Why Is It Important?
MOQ is the smallest quantity of a product that a supplier is willing to sell. This term is critical for B2B transactions, as it affects inventory management and cost efficiency. Buyers should be aware of MOQs to ensure they can meet their operational needs without overcommitting resources. -
RFQ (Request for Quotation): How Should It Be Used?
An RFQ is a document that buyers send to suppliers to request pricing and other relevant details for a specific quantity of goods. For the Fuli-S aspirator bulb, submitting an RFQ can help buyers obtain competitive pricing and terms, facilitating better negotiation opportunities. -
Incoterms (International Commercial Terms): What Are They?
Incoterms define the responsibilities of buyers and sellers in international shipping agreements. Familiarity with these terms is essential for buyers from regions like Africa and South America, as they dictate shipping costs, risk management, and delivery timelines. -
Lead Time: How Does It Affect Delivery?
Lead time refers to the time it takes from placing an order to receiving the goods. Understanding lead times is crucial for B2B buyers to plan their inventory and manage supply chain disruptions effectively.
